Hi everyone. I am a newbie here and desperately need help with my ailing external hard drive (firewire).
The problem is it won't mount to my Mac G4 desktop. I am running OS 10.3. I have tried hooking this up to another computer - no luck. I have tried a new firewire cable. When I open disk utilities the LaCie is recognized. When I run Disk First Aid it tells me the drive is damaged. I have contacted Drive Savers, as recommended by the LaCie web site. They sent me a quote of about $2000 to recover the data. The hard drive does not make any strange noises. Does anyone have any suggestions??? I do not have $2000 to spend recovering the data. I am hesitant to run Norton since Drive Savers says this may damage the disk further. Help! Any ideas are much appreciated! |
